Transaction 4bf521fae2eb804812368e7459e482cd786eae18a41daf887c1c27d6912ca3ee

1 Input
1 Outputs
  • 4bf521fae2eb804812368e7459e482cd786eae18a41daf887c1c27d6912ca3ee:0
  • value  670793
    address  15Mvq2Si7aXa1mYodq9fwf4i7fEsWFpjyS